首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

复制和随机化列表中项目的位置

是指将列表中的项目进行复制或随机调整顺序的操作。

复制列表项目的位置可以通过将列表中的项目复制到新的位置来实现。这在需要重复使用列表中的项目或在列表中插入重复的项目时非常有用。可以使用编程语言提供的列表复制方法来实现,如Python中的copy()函数或JavaScript中的slice()函数。在复制列表项目的位置时,需要注意确保每个项目在列表中的唯一性,以避免混淆或重复。

随机化列表中项目的位置是将列表中的项目按照随机的顺序重新排列。这对于需要随机选择列表中的项目或为列表创建随机排序的需求非常有用。可以使用编程语言提供的随机函数来实现列表的随机化,如Python中的random.shuffle()函数或JavaScript中的array.sort()结合随机函数的使用。随机化列表项目的位置可以帮助提高数据的随机性和多样性,从而更好地满足不同场景的需求。

下面是关于复制和随机化列表中项目的位置的一些常见问题和答案:

  1. 为什么要复制和随机化列表中项目的位置? 复制列表项目的位置可以方便地在列表中重复使用项目或插入重复的项目。随机化列表项目的位置可以帮助实现随机选择项目或创建随机排序的需求。
  2. 如何复制列表中的项目位置? 可以使用编程语言提供的列表复制方法,如Python中的copy()函数或JavaScript中的slice()函数来复制列表中的项目位置。
  3. 如何随机化列表中的项目位置? 可以使用编程语言提供的随机函数,如Python中的random.shuffle()函数或JavaScript中的array.sort()结合随机函数的使用来随机化列表中的项目位置。
  4. 复制和随机化列表中项目位置有哪些应用场景? 复制列表项目的位置适用于需要重复使用或插入重复项目的场景,如在游戏开发中生成多个相同的敌人或在数据处理中重复使用相同的规则。随机化列表项目的位置适用于需要随机选择或创建随机排序的场景,如在抽奖活动中随机选择获奖者或在音乐播放器中创建随机播放列表。
  5. 腾讯云相关产品和产品介绍链接地址 腾讯云提供了丰富的云计算产品和解决方案,其中与列表操作相关的产品包括:
  • 对象存储(COS):腾讯云对象存储服务,可用于存储和管理列表数据。详细介绍可参考腾讯云对象存储(COS)
  • 云函数(SCF):腾讯云云函数服务,可用于编写和执行列表操作相关的函数。详细介绍可参考腾讯云云函数(SCF)
  • 数据库(CDB):腾讯云数据库服务,可用于存储和管理列表数据。详细介绍可参考腾讯云数据库(CDB)

请注意,以上只是腾讯云提供的一些与列表操作相关的产品,还有更多产品和解决方案可根据具体需求进行选择和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分21秒

腾讯位置 - 逆地址解析

领券